Zusammenfassung: | Scientific literacy depends upon children's early engagement in science. It is in the elementary school years that teachers have an opportunity to cultivate and nourish their students' innate curiosity about the world. Well-taught science classes help give students the skills to investigate problems logically and systematically and make informed decisions based on evidence - skills that can serve young people the rest of their lives. Unfortunately, many teachers are ill-prepared to teach these classes. Drawing on the knowledge and experience of a panel of leaders in elementary education and in science education and the results of a survey of 142 teacher education programs, editors Senta A. Raizen and Arie M. Michelsohn offer a new vision for preparing prospective teachers of grades K through six in science content and pedagogy - a vision that will transform teachers from people who merely pass on someone else's knowledge to creative facilitators of children's learning through involvement in the process of science investigation. The authors include a three-part interchangeable model for preparing teachers in science, and they outline the basics of what prospective elementary school teachers need to learn in science courses and in science pedagogy courses, including fundamental underlying concepts, habits of mind, and effective instructional strategies. The recommended courses and programs will arm teachers with powerful tools necessary for a true understanding of science learning in children. |
